Dead Pool Intro
Dead Pool, located in Jungutbatu, Nusa Lembongan, Klungkung Regency, Bali, Indonesia, is a popular destination for adventure seekers looking for a thrilling cliff jumping experience. This natural pool, formed by rock formations along the coast, offers a unique and exhilarating activity for those who dare to take the plunge.
Environment: Dead Pool is situated amidst the stunning coastal scenery of Nusa Lembongan. The surrounding cliffs and rocky formations create a dramatic backdrop for this natural pool. The crystal-clear waters of the pool offer a refreshing respite after the adrenaline rush of the jump.
Services and Features: Dead Pool is primarily a natural attraction, with limited services directly at the site. You may find some local vendors selling drinks and snacks nearby. However, it's advisable to bring your own necessities, especially if you plan to spend some time at the location. There are no lifeguards at Dead Pool, so caution is advised when cliff jumping.
Specialties: The main draw of Dead Pool is the exhilarating cliff jump. The height of the jump varies depending on the tide and water level, but it generally offers a significant thrill for those who take the leap. The natural pool provides a safe landing spot, as long as jumpers follow safety guidelines and assess the conditions before jumping.
Additional Tourist Attraction Promotion Information:
- Accessibility: Dead Pool is located on the island of Nusa Lembongan, which can be reached by ferry or speedboat from Sanur, Bali. Once on Nusa Lembongan, you can rent a motorbike or hire a driver to reach Dead Pool. The roads can be rough in some areas, so caution is advised.
- Things to Note: Cliff jumping at Dead Pool is a potentially dangerous activity and should only be attempted by those who are comfortable with heights and strong swimmers. It's crucial to assess the conditions of the pool and surrounding rocks before jumping. Never jump alone, and always check the depth of the water before taking the plunge.
- Nearby Attractions: Nusa Lembongan offers several other stunning attractions, including Mushroom Bay, Jungut Batu Beach, and Devil's Tears. These destinations are often visited together due to their proximity.
